Objectif(s): Sea ice is decreasing at an alarming rate throughout the northern hemisphere. The researchers will collect information from an aerial survey platform which can be used to produce better estimates of sea ice concentration in the fall and spring using passive microwave satellite remote sensing information. This information will allow the researcher to more precisely calibrate the satellite data and thus produce better regional estimations of the reduction in sea ice in the ISR.
